This video highlights the groundbreaking technology of the early 2000s that left us in awe. It showcases innovations like the launch of the first iPod, which transformed the way we listened to music, and the rise of DVD players, which quickly replaced VHS as the standard for home entertainment. The video also explores the game-changing impact of high-speed broadband internet, which revolutionized the way we browsed and interacted online, along with the debut of flat-panel LCD TVs that made large-screen, high-definition viewing more accessible. Other milestones include the introduction of the first digital cameras for consumers and the rise of early smartphones like the BlackBerry, setting the stage for the mobile revolution that would follow.WATCH:
